The Last Echo of the Dragon's Embrace
In the heart of the star system of Aeloria, where the cosmos danced in a symphony of colors, lay the planet of Elysia. It was a world of lush greenery, crystal-clear rivers, and towering mountains that whispered secrets of ancient times. Among its inhabitants was the princess of Elysia, Elara, a young woman with eyes that held the depth of the cosmos and a heart that yearned for the stars.
The legend of the Dragon's Tear was a tale told in the hallowed halls of Elysian royalty. It spoke of a time when the Dragon of Elysia, a celestial being of immense power, would weep, and its tears would fall upon a chosen one, granting them immense power and destiny. But the tale also warned of a betrayer, one who would seek to steal the Dragon's Tear for their own dark purposes.
Elara's life was a tapestry of royal duties and dreams of the stars. She was a scholar, a warrior, and a dreamer, but above all, she was a lover of the Dragon of Elysia. She spent her days in the library, poring over ancient scrolls, and her nights gazing at the night sky, dreaming of the day when she might meet the Dragon in person.
One fateful night, as Elara watched the stars, a shimmering tear of light descended from the heavens, landing in her open palm. The entire kingdom witnessed the event, and the prophecy was fulfilled. Elara felt a surge of power, a connection to the Dragon that she could not explain.
The king, Elara's father, decreed a grand celebration, but in the shadows, a plot was being woven. A man named Kael, once a loyal advisor to the king, had been coveting the Dragon's Tear for years. He saw it as a tool to seize power and reshape the universe to his will. Kael's eyes gleamed with malice as he watched Elara hold the tear, his mind churning with schemes.
Elara, unaware of Kael's treachery, began to feel the weight of her destiny. She trained rigorously, seeking to understand the power within her. The king, sensing her potential, arranged for her to meet with the elders of the kingdom, who revealed that Elara was to be the guardian of the Dragon's Tear, ensuring it would not fall into the wrong hands.
As Elara's fame spread, suitors from across the galaxy sought her hand. Among them was Theron, a pilot of great renown, who had always admired the princess from afar. Elara, however, was torn between her loyalty to her kingdom and her growing affection for Theron.
Kael, watching the developments, saw his chance. He infiltrated the royal guard and, under the guise of a mission, managed to get close to Elara. One night, as Elara was meditating in her chamber, Kael crept in and seized the Dragon's Tear from her hand.
Elara awoke to find the tear gone and Kael standing before her, a cold, calculating smile on his face. "The world will soon bow to my will, Princess," Kael said, his voice dripping with malice. "The Dragon's Tear is but a stepping stone."
Elara, her eyes blazing with fury and pain, vowed to reclaim the tear and thwart Kael's plans. She turned to Theron, who had been keeping watch over her. "We must leave now," Elara said, her voice steady. "The Dragon's Tear is the key to stopping Kael."
Together, they set out on a journey through the stars, facing countless dangers. They sought the aid of the Dragon of Elysia, who, in the form of a majestic dragon, revealed that the Dragon's Tear was a piece of the Dragon itself, imbued with its ancient wisdom and power.
As they approached the final challenge, Elara and Theron were ambushed by Kael's forces. In a fierce battle, Elara and Theron fought valiantly, but Kael's power was overwhelming. It was then that the Dragon of Elysia intervened, its wings casting a blinding light upon the battlefield.
Elara, with the Dragon's guidance, managed to confront Kael. In a climactic struggle, she fought with all her newfound strength and the power of the Dragon's Tear. The battle raged on until, with a final, desperate effort, Elara struck Kael down, his body shattering into a million pieces.
With Kael defeated, the Dragon's Tear was safe. Elara and Theron returned to Elysia, where they were hailed as heroes. The kingdom thrived under Elara's rule, and Theron became her closest ally. The Dragon of Elysia, forever grateful, bestowed upon them a gift: a child, born with the ability to communicate with the stars.
As the years passed, Elara and Theron watched their son grow, a reminder of the love that had brought them together and the courage that had saved their world. And so, the tale of the Dragon's Tear became a legend, a story of love, betrayal, and the indomitable spirit of those who choose to fight for what is right.
